在c#中创建一个文件

时间:2015-03-13 04:36:35

标签: c#

using System;
using System.IO;

namespace CreateFile
{

    class MainClass
    {

        public static void Main (string[] args)
        {
            Console.WriteLine ("Enter the File name:");
            string filename = Console.ReadLine (); 
            System.IO.File.Create(@"G:\New folder (5)\" + filename);            
        }
    }


}

1 个答案:

答案 0 :(得分:1)

您可以使用这种方式:

using System; using System.IO;

namespace CreateFile {

class MainClass
{

        public static void Main (string[] args)
        {
        Console.WriteLine ("Enter the File name:");
        string filename = Console.ReadLine (); 
        FileInfo fi = new FileInfo(@"G:\New folder (5)\" + filename + ".txt");
        //You can use any extension to create respective file.
                StreamWriter sw;

                if (!fi.Exists)
                {
                    using (FileStream fs = fi.Create())
                    {

                    }
                }
        }
    }
}